The Lord's Supper (Communion, Eucharist)
•The Lord's Supper is a holy meal of bread and wine that symbolizes the body and blood of Christ.
•The Lord's Supper recalls the life, death and resurrection of Jesus and celebrates the unity of all the members of God's family.
•By sharing this meal, we give thanks for Christ's sacrifice and are nourished and empowered to go into the world in mission and ministry.
•We practice "open Communion," welcoming all who love Christ, repent of their sin, and seek to live in peace with one another.
